前端场景面试题 -- 技术调研

前端场景面试题 -- 技术调研

在部门转岗的时候被问到能否进行一些技术调研的工作。方式回答是可以,但是这种工作做的不多,幸好没有深入问打算怎么做,索性逃过一劫。后面复盘了一下,又对之前做过的技术调研进行了总结,抽象了一个纲要出来,供大家参考和审阅。

问题:作为前端开发工程师,领导安排你做技术调研,你该如何规划,请给出切实可行的步骤,并举例说明你的做法。

答案:按照一下十个步骤一次完成技术调研

  1. 明确调研目标:与领导详细讨论,明确调研的目标和预期结果。了解领导对该技术调研的具体需求和关注点。

  2. 界定调研范围:确定调研的范围和涉及的关键点。指定具体的研究方向、技术领域或特定解决方案,以便将调研过程保持聚焦和高效。

  3. 收集资料和文献:根据调研的目标,收集相关的资料、文献和相关技术文档。利用互联网、技术博客、学术论文等资源,获取最新的技术信息。

  4. 制定调研计划:制定详细的调研计划,包括时间安排、资源需求、研究方法和工具等。确保调研的高效进行和资源的合理利用。

  5. 进行深入实践:基于调研的目标和计划,进行实际的实践和试验。可以通过编写示例代码、搭建环境、模拟场景等方式,对目标技术进行实际操作和测试。

  6. 分析和总结调研结果:分析收集到的资料,总结调研的结果。整理出关键的发现、优缺点、适用场景等信息,并形成结构化的报告或演示文稿。

  7. 准备成果展示:根据调研结果,准备详细的技术调研报告或演示文稿。确保展示内容清晰、逻辑有序,并能够向领导和团队成员有效传递核心信息。

  8. 与领导和团队分享和讨论:安排与领导和其他相关团队成员的会议或讨论,分享调研成果,接受他们的反馈和意见。这有助于确保调研结果得到充分的理解和应用。

  9. 评估调研价值和可行性:基于调研的结果和反馈,评估技术调研的价值和对项目的可行性。通过与领导和团队的讨论,确定进一步采纳或发展该技术的计划。

  10. 记录和沉淀:最后,将调研过程、结果和反馈进行记录,形成知识库或技术文档,以便今后参考和分享。

通过以上步骤的规划,你可以有条不紊地进行技术调研,并提供切实可行的调研结果,以支持领导和团队的决策和项目的进展。

之前我的领导安排我去调研tauri,并讨论对现有c端框架electron替换的可能性,我采用的具体方案为:

  1. 明确调研目标:与领导进一步讨论,明确你们对 Tauri 的调研目标,探索 Tauri 是否适合替换 Electron,了解 Tauri 在性能、安全性等方面的优势。

  2. 界定调研范围:确定要对 Tauri 进行的具体调研,了解 Tauri 的基本概念和架构、查看 Tauri 的生态系统和社区支持、探索 Tauri 在性能和安全性方面的特点等。

  3. 收集资料和文献:通过阅读官方文档、查阅技术博客和学术论文等,收集关于 Tauri 的资料和相关文献。了解 Tauri 的功能、用例和最佳实践,以及与 Electron 相比的优劣势。

  4. 制定调研计划:根据调研的目标和范围,制定调研计划。安排时间查阅文档、参与社区讨论、尝试示例代码和构建基础应用等。

  5. 进行深入实践:根据调研计划,进行实际的实践和尝试。使用 Tauri 构建一个简单的示例应用,探索其开发过程、构建和打包、性能和资源占用等方面的特点。

  6. 分析和总结调研结果:分析收集到的资料和实践结果,总结调研的结果。记录 Tauri 的优点、限制和适用场景,以及可能的迁移成本和团队适应性等方面的观察。

  7. 准备成果展示:根据调研结果,准备详细的技术调研报告或演示文稿。展示 Tauri 的功能、特点和潜在价值,并提供与 Electron 的对比和建议。

  8. 与领导和团队分享和讨论:安排分享会议或讨论与领导和相关团队成员分享调研成果。接受他们的反馈和意见,讨论 Tauri 的优势、适用性和可能的风险。

  9. 评估调研价值和可行性:基于调研的结果和团队的反馈,评估 Tauri 在你们的项目中的价值和可行性。与领导和团队一起讨论是否采用 Tauri 或混合使用 Tauri 和 Electron 等进一步的决策。

  10. 记录和沉淀:最后,将调研过程、结果和反馈进行记录,形成知识库或技术文档,以便今后参考和分享,帮助团队更好地使用和评估 Tauri。

相关推荐
也无晴也无风雨1 小时前
深入剖析输入URL按下回车,浏览器做了什么
前端·后端·计算机网络
Martin -Tang2 小时前
Vue 3 中,ref 和 reactive的区别
前端·javascript·vue.js
SRY122404193 小时前
javaSE面试题
java·开发语言·面试
FakeOccupational3 小时前
nodejs 020: React语法规则 props和state
前端·javascript·react.js
放逐者-保持本心,方可放逐3 小时前
react 组件应用
开发语言·前端·javascript·react.js·前端框架
曹天骄4 小时前
next中服务端组件共享接口数据
前端·javascript·react.js
阮少年、5 小时前
java后台生成模拟聊天截图并返回给前端
java·开发语言·前端
不二人生6 小时前
SQL面试题——连续出现次数
hive·sql·面试
郝晨妤6 小时前
鸿蒙ArkTS和TS有什么区别?
前端·javascript·typescript·鸿蒙
AvatarGiser6 小时前
《ElementPlus 与 ElementUI 差异集合》Icon 图标 More 差异说明
前端·vue.js·elementui